Description:

At Hennessy, service advisors are the face of the service department and play a crucial role in building trust and gaining repeat business with our service customers. As a service advisor, you are the liaison between the customer and technician and are responsible for ensuring an excellent experience.

What you'll do:

Greet customers on the lane and perform a walk-around of the vehicle upon arrival.

Acknowledge automotive problems and services needed by listening to the customer's description of symptoms; clarify description of problems; conduct vehicle inspection with the customer; take test drives when needed; check vehicle maintenance records; answer service calls and schedule appointments when needed

Prepare repair orders by describing symptoms, problems, and causes discovered as well as repairs and services required; obtain approval signatures and enter repair orders into the Reynolds & Reynolds system correctly and promptly..

Establish and maintain customer relations by explaining estimates and expected completion time; obtain customer's approval of estimates and repairs; record contact information; answer questions and concerns that arise; arrange towing and temporary transportation as needed.

Verify warranty and service contract coverage; explain provisions and exclusions in detail to customers.

Develop estimates by costing materials, supplies and labor; calculate customer's payment, including deductibles.

Maintain vehicle records by recording service and repairs.

Update job and product knowledge as required by Hennessy or the manufacturer.

Communicate professionally and provide updates on customer repairs as needed to technicians and the parts department.
